New Grower Danielsaaan’s Mephisto Grow - Double Grape & Strawberry Nuggets

Day 42: Top dressed 1/4c Coast of Maine Fish Bone Meal. Watered in with tap and Quillaja til slight runoff. Left DLI where it’s at for now - which is ~33 currently.
